Then came the perfect music genre to celebrate the 40th episode of the Overlooked Tracks Podcast and this time we’re celebrating the BOOM-BAP sounds of TRIP-HOP.  Trying to find a good way to describe this music genre because most websites I found all stated the same thing:  Trip-Hop is dead!!  Just like other music genres from previous episodes, music is not dead unless the world decides not to hear it anymore!!  Well, I found six music artists that says otherwise - Trip Hop is alive and thriving and a reemerged form of the music is here to demonstrate its power.  Thanks to the masters of Massive Attack, Portishead, Tricky and DJ Krush (just to name a few), displaying the maestros of sounds, lyric and beats of Trip Hop.
